13.07.2015 Views

SEGURIDAD EN UNIX Y REDES

SEGURIDAD EN UNIX Y REDES

SEGURIDAD EN UNIX Y REDES

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

158Connection closed by foreign host.luisa:~# telnet 158.42.2.1Trying 158.42.2.1...Connected to pleione.cc.upv.esEscape character is ’^]’.Connection closed by foreign host.luisa:~#CAPÍTULO 10. EL SISTEMA DE RED10.2.2 El archivo /etc/ethersDe la misma forma que en /etc/hosts se establecía una correspondencia entre nombres de máquinay sus direcciones ip, en este fichero se establece una correspondencia entre nombres de máquina ydirecciones ethernet, en un formato muy similar al archivo anterior:00:20:18:72:c7:95pleione.cc.upv.esEn la actualidad el archivo /etc/ethers no se suele encontrar (aunque para el sistema sigue conservandosu funcionalidad, es decir, si existe se tiene en cuenta) en casi ninguna máquina Unix, yaque las direcciones hardware se obtienen por arp.10.2.3 El fichero /etc/networksEste fichero, cada vez más en desuso, permite asignar un nombre simbólico a las redes, de unaforma similar a lo que /etc/hosts hace con las máquinas. En cada línea del fichero se especificaun nombre de red, su dirección, y sus aliases:luisa:~# cat /etc/networksloopback 127.0.0.0localnet 195.195.5.0luisa:~#El uso de este fichero es casi exclusivo del arranque del sistema, cuando aún no se dispone deservidores de nombres; en la operación habitual del sistema no se suele utilizar, ya que ha sidodesplazado por dns.10.2.4 El fichero /etc/servicesEn cada línea de este fichero se especifican el nombre, número de puerto, protocolo utilizado yaliases de todos los servicios de red existentes (o, si no de todos los existentes, de un subconjunto losuficientemente amplio para que ciertos programas de red funcionen correctamente). Por ejemplo,para especificar que el servicio de smtp utilizará el puerto 25, el protocolo tcp y que un alias paraél es mail, existirá una línea similar a la siguiente:smtp 25/tcp mailEl fichero /etc/services es utilizado por los servidores y por los clientes para obtener el número depuerto en el que deben escuchar o al que deben enviar peticiones, de forma que se pueda cambiar(aunque no es lo habitual) un número de puerto sin afectar a las aplicaciones; de esta forma,podemos utilizar el nombre del servicio en un programa y la función getservicebyname() en lugarde utilizar el número del puerto:luisa:~# telnet anita 25Trying 195.195.5.3...Connected to anita.Escape character is ’^]’.220 anita ESMTP Sendmail 8.9.1b+Sun/8.9.1; Sun, 31 Oct 1999 06:43:06 GMTquit

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!